All DeKalb County children will still have access to a daily meal while school is out, through a program run by the county parks department.

The summer food program is open to al children up to 18 years old and features a daily nutritious meal at DeKalb rec centers, parks, day camps and community centers. The U.S. Department of Agriculture funds the program.
